Live Oak Quarter-Sawn Boards

Quarter-sawn live oak (Quercus virginiana) boards, sliced lengthwise with thickness exceeding 6mm, sanded for woodworking. Specifically oak (Quercus spp.) under 4407.91.00, valued for shipbuilding and durability.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

4407.11.00Same rate: 35%

If coniferous like pine

Coniferous sawn wood falls under separate 4407.11, not hardwood oak category.

4410Lower: 10% vs 35%

If particleboard made from oak

Oak particles agglomerated into board classify under 4410 for particleboard.

4403Lower: 10% vs 35%

If in rough log form

Unsawn oak logs remain under 4403, only sawn lengthwise enters 4407.

Import Tips & Compliance

โ€ข Include CITES documentation if from protected stands; measure and certify planed thickness >6mm; check for end-jointing which must still qualify under 4407 not 4418
